Job Details

Role: Java Developer

Location: REMOTE Must live in the Appleton metro area

Type: W2 Contract

MS Teams Video Interview

Job Summary:

Develop or modify software applications with minimal supervision. Codes, tests, debugs, documents, and maintains software. Complete small to large projects involving software development and information systems principles. Will work with software development team, operations team, and outside resources.

Responsibilities:

  • Analyze requirements, design, code, and debug java applications
  • Apply regression testing techniques to ensure quality of deployed applications
  • Deliver support and maintenance of Division's Java application
  • Utilize a full lifecycle application development process leveraging Agile
  • Continually improve applications through performance tuning, balancing, usability, and automation
  • Provide support, maintain and document developed applications and interfaces
  • Integrate software with existing systems
  • Actively plan and manage continuous multiple small to medium sized projects
  • Evaluate and identify new technologies and methodologies to apply to the Division's business
  • Comply to established standards
  • Live our values of High Performance, Caring Relationships, Strategic Foresight, and Entrepreneurial Spirit
  • Find A Better Way by championing continuous improvement and quality control efforts to identify opportunities to innovate and improve efficiency, accuracy, and standardization
  • Continuously learn and develop self professionally
  • Support corporate efforts for safety, government compliance, and all other company policies & procedures
  • Perform other related duties as required and assigned

Qualifications:

  • Bachelors Degree in Computer Science / Computer Engineering and 3 years experience
  • Programming experience in Java preferred.
  • Microsoft C# considered as well.
  • Proficiency in Web Development and Design (, Web Services, ASP, HTML) is a plus
  • Proficiency in MS SQL Server
  • Proficiency in programming techniques, algorithms, data structures, object oriented programming and Agile
  • Available to handle multiple task assignments and manage around deadlines
  • Ability to set short and long range plans and adjust his/her direction
  • Excellent communication, customer service, problem solving and analytical skills to connect with team and business partners
  • Active and continual learner
  • Ability to work independently or with a team
